i <br /> I <br /> San Joaquin County <br /> Environmental Health Department <br /> o. c DIRECTOR <br /> 2.• $ G Donna Heran,REHS <br /> A <br /> :i 1868 East Hazelton Avenue <br /> PROGRAM COORDINATORS i <br /> Stockton, California 95295-6232 Robert McClellon,REHS <br /> Jeff Garruesco,RENS, RDI <br /> CgClo •N�P Website: www.sjgov.org/ehd Kasey Foley, REHS <br /> Phone: (209)468-3420 Linda Turkatte,REHSRodney Estrada,REHS <br /> Fax: (209) 464-0138 Adrienne Ellsaesser, REHS <br /> September Oak, 2013 <br /> Walter L. & Lenna Shockey Ti? <br /> c/o Leroy Shockey <br /> 205 Pedras Road <br /> Turlock, CA 95352 <br /> Subject: SHOCKEY TRUCKING Site Code: 2581 <br /> 850 Milgeo Ave <br /> Ripon, CA 95382. <br /> Dear Leroy Shockey: <br /> i <br /> This letter confirms the completion of a site investigation and corrective action for the underground <br /> storage tank(s) formerly located at the above-described location. Thank you for your cooperation <br /> throughout this investigation. Your willingness and promptness in responding to our inquiries concerning <br /> the former underground storage tank(s) are greatly appreciated. <br /> Based on information in the above-referenced file and with the provision that the information provided to <br /> this agency was accurate and representative of site conditions, this agency finds that the site <br /> investigation and corrective action carried out at your underground storage tank(s) site is in compliance <br /> with the requirements of subdivisions (a) and (b) of Section 25296.10 of the California Health and Safety <br /> Code (CHSC) and with corrective action .regulations adopted pursuant to Section 25299.3, CHSC. No <br /> further action related to the petroleum release(s) at the site is required. <br /> Claims for reimbursement of corrective action costs submitted to the State Wader Resources Control <br /> Board (SWRCB) Underground Storage Tank Cleanup Fund more than 365 days after the date of this <br /> letter or issuance or activation of the Fund's Letter of Commitment, whichever occurs later, will not be <br /> reimbursed unless one of the following exceptions applies: <br /> a Claims are submitted pursuant to Section 25299.57, subdivision (i:) (reopened UST case); or <br /> Q Submission within the timefrarne is beyond the claimant's reasonable control; ongoing work is <br /> required for closure €hat :,rill result in the submission of claims beyond that time period; or that <br /> under the circumstances of the case, 4 ,,could be unreasonable or inequitable to impose the <br /> 365-day time period. <br /> l <br />
